Output 0934383ef0b1e2fd7dd88e5a8066849a95cdcb454e207195c92792eef8f6288d:0

value
30615129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bec12f2ad16968eb890a2ab6ba9a289152abe6c OP_EQUAL
address
34EeyS5xxNSfh1hzbRptxYZMc9ethQkLMe
transaction
0934383ef0b1e2fd7dd88e5a8066849a95cdcb454e207195c92792eef8f6288d
spent
true